= Intrinsically Unfolded Proteins (IUP) =
Recently recognized as a distinct category of proteins <ref>PMID: 10550212</ref><ref>PMID: 11381529</ref><ref>PMID: 11784292</ref>.  Also known as intrinsically disordered proteins (IDP) or natively unfolded proteins.

The term refers to proteins or to sequences within proteins that, under physiological conditions ''in-vitro'', display physicochemical characteristics resembling those of random coils. Possessing little or no ordered structure with extended conformation and high intra-molecular flexibility, lacking of a tightly packed core.
